Troy Smith's statistics on the year:

40-76, 452 yards, 2 touchdowns, 0 interceptions, sacked 4 times, 12 rushes for 54 yards and a touchdown. 79.5 QB rating.

His touchdown percentage is 2.6%. Boller's is 3.3%. Boller has an interception percentage of 3.6%. Troy's is 0.0%.

When you compare his stats to those of other rookie QBs:

Brady Quinn was 3 for 8 for 45 yards, 0 TDs, 0 Ints, 0 sacks, 56.8 QB rating in his limited action debut. By contrast, Troy was 3-5 for 33 yards and ran one time for 6 yards and a score in his limited action debut.

Trent Edwards: 151-269, 1,630 yards, 7 TDs, 8 Ints, 12 sacks, 70.4 QB rating.

John Beck: 60-107, 559 yards, 1 touchdown, 3 Ints, 10 sacks, 62.0 QB rating.

JaMarcus Russell: 33-66, 373 yards, 2 TDs, 4 Ints, 6 sacks, 55.9 QB rating.

Anyway, the one thing you will notice from the 3 other rookie QBs that got extensive playing time is that they made mistakes and threw interceptions. Troy Smith did not throw an interception. Troy was also able to avoid the rush and many sacks.

The team says good things about him. They seem to give him their vote of confidence. Troy Smith has to start next year. It is only fair.

All in all, Troy did quite well for himself when given the chance, but the 0 INT's is a little misleading. He had a couple potential interceptions dropped. While I'm not big enough a homer to say that he played well enough to be the leading candidate to be a starter next year, I'd say he did enough to hopefully earn a shot. Two big things he may have going for him is that his teammates definately seem to respond to him and he showed the ability to make plays when the pocket brakes down. Much of it will depend on which direction the ratbirds go with their 1st rounder. If they go QB, he'll be facing a major roadblock. I'd be amazed if they bring Boller back, thats for sure...but I'm sure billick will have a big say in that, so who knows.
